White Possum Naked Dark Cacao - Australian Bitter Chocolate Liqueur
Naked Dark Cacao is a bittersweet concoction of organic fermented cacao, a selection of earthy roots and a good measure of tangy yet floral lilly pillies.Pre-fermented to bring out all that chocolatey goodness, the maceration is aged for a month while giving it a gentle stir at regular intervals until the aroma becomes unbearably enticing. The team then adds several infusions of bitter roots for a lingering bitterness and a handful of native lilly pillies (riberries) to lend a floral note. Finally, a decent lick of dark sugar is added to bind everything together with a velvety texture.White Possum use real ingredients throughout and deliberately avoid filtering the liqueur to ensure no flavour is filtered out, so you may notice some sediment and oils that may drift out of the liqueur over time. Simply give your bottle a quick shake and all will be normal again!

Gordons Gin
Founded by Alexander Gordon in 1769, the Gordon's recipe has remained almost untouched since its creation. Triple-distilled, the gin contains juniper berries, coriander seeds and angelica root to name a few. Perfectly enjoyed in a classic Gin and Tonic.

Never Never Triple Juniper Gin
Pine needle, brushed rosemary, lemon oil, earthy root extending into fragrant pepper. The palate is immediately fragrant with a bright citrus character up front. Oily and intense, the juniper is prominent, supported by the earthy undertones of angelica and orris root and extended by the addition of wooded spices and pepper. The finish is long and complex with a rich creaminess that dries out almost immediately. There is a changing dynamic of juniper, first bright and fragrant that develops into an earthy more resinous finish. The length is full and luxurious. The Triple Juniper is one of those drinks that makes you ask: Why on earth has nobody created a gin like this before? It is brimming with the brightness of the best juniper in the world, air freighted in for freshness. We treat the juniper in three distinct ways, partially steeped, partially in the pot and partially in the vapour, in carefully selected balance, to capture both the bright and the earthy qualities of this wonder berry. Well, it's actually the world's smallest conifer, but let's not get too technical. The copious amounts of juniper give you the best thing about gin in spades. But juniper is a force that needs managing. A carefully selected bouquet of botanicals honours the brilliance of the juniper by complementing it, rather than overpowering it. Australian coriander provides a brighter citrus and less earthiness than its English or Indian counterparts. A predominate fresh lemon citrus influence with a touch of fresh lime and liquorice lifts it up over a root base of angelica and orris. Native pepperberry provides a balancing savoury element without the heavy menthol finish of traditional peppers. A hint of cinnamon the just the right amount of warmth.
